1. Rise of Documentary Style Photography

documentary style wedding photography examplesDocumentary style photography is gaining popularity among couples looking for a more authentic representation of their wedding day. This approach focuses on capturing candid moments and genuine emotions rather than staged poses. Photographers who specialize in this style tell a story through their images, allowing couples to relive the day as it unfolded. For instance, the joy of a shared laugh, a tear during vows, or the dance floor energy is highlighted, making the final album feel like a heartfelt narrative. Couples appreciate this style because it feels more personal and true to their experience, moving away from the traditional posed shots that can feel disconnected from the actual event.

2. Unique Perspectives with Drone Photography

drone photography weddings imagesDrone photography is set to redefine how weddings are captured in 2025. With the ability to soar above the venue, drones provide breathtaking aerial views that ground-level photography simply cannot match. This unique perspective allows couples to showcase their wedding location, whether it’s a stunning beach, a majestic mountain backdrop, or a charming garden. For instance, a couple getting married on a vineyard can have sweeping shots of the lush rows of grapes combined with the festivities below, creating a visual narrative that tells their story from above.

Additionally, drone photography can capture dynamic moments, such as the couple's first dance or the grand exit, from a bird's-eye view. This not only adds a layer of creativity to the photography but also enhances the overall storytelling of the wedding day. As technology continues to evolve, photographers are expected to master drone operations, ensuring high-quality images that blend seamlessly with traditional photography.

3. Embracing Sustainable Practices in Photography

As the world becomes more aware of environmental issues, wedding photographers are stepping up to embrace sustainable practices. This trend involves adopting eco-friendly methods that reduce waste and minimize the carbon footprint associated with wedding photography. For instance, many photographers are shifting towards digital contracts and online galleries, which eliminate the need for paper. Additionally, sustainable printing options are gaining popularity, with photographers opting for eco-conscious materials and processes that are less harmful to the environment.

Moreover, some photographers are choosing to partner with local businesses that prioritize sustainability, ensuring that every aspect of the wedding day, from the venue to the catering, aligns with eco-friendly values. This approach not only resonates with environmentally-conscious couples but also showcases a commitment to preserving the planet for future generations. Couples can feel good knowing their special day is captured in a way that respects the environment, aligning with their values and making a positive impact.

Practice Description Benefits
Digital Contracts Using online contracts instead of paper ones. Reduces paper waste and speeds up the booking process.
Online Galleries Providing couples with digital galleries instead of physical albums. Minimizes printing costs and environmental impact.
Sustainable Printing Methods Adopting eco-friendly printing options for physical products. Supports environmental sustainability and reduces carbon footprint.
Locally Sourced Materials Utilizing locally sourced materials for album production and props. Supports local businesses and reduces transportation emissions.
Energy-Efficient Equipment Using energy-efficient cameras and lighting during shoots. Lowers energy consumption and promotes sustainability initiatives.

5. Film Photography Makes a Comeback

Film photography is experiencing a revival as couples seek a vintage aesthetic that digital often cannot replicate. The unique texture and depth provided by film can give wedding photos a timeless quality. Photographers are dusting off their old cameras and experimenting with different film stocks to create images that evoke nostalgia. For example, using a medium format film can produce stunning portraits with rich colors, while black and white film captures raw emotion beautifully. This trend not only appeals to couples wanting a distinctive style but also attracts photographers who appreciate the art and craftsmanship of shooting on film. As a result, many are incorporating both digital and film photography into their packages, allowing couples to enjoy the best of both worlds.

9. Advanced Editing Techniques for Unique Images

In 2025, wedding photographers are expected to push the boundaries of creativity through advanced editing techniques. This includes experimenting with light leaks and double exposures, which can add a dreamy or nostalgic feel to wedding photos. For instance, a couple might have a shot of their first dance layered with a soft-focus image of their venue, creating a romantic memory that blends two moments into one. Additionally, the use of film grain effects can mimic the vintage look of classic photography, appealing to couples who desire that timeless aesthetic. These techniques not only enhance the visual appeal of images but also allow photographers to tell a more artistic story of the couple's special day.

12. Popularity of Pre-Wedding and Post-Wedding Shoots

Pre-wedding and post-wedding shoots are gaining immense popularity among couples planning their weddings in 2025. These sessions allow couples to express their personalities and capture their love story in various settings and styles, offering a creative outlet outside the formalities of the wedding day. For example, couples might choose a scenic spot where they had their first date or a location that holds special meaning for them. These shoots also serve as a great opportunity for couples to get comfortable in front of the camera before the big day, resulting in more natural and relaxed photos during the wedding. Post-wedding shoots, on the other hand, can take place in dream destinations or unique venues that were not feasible for the wedding day due to time constraints. This trend not only enhances the couple's photographic collection but also allows them to create lasting memories in diverse environments.

13. Combining Professional and Guest Photography

In 2025, the trend of integrating professional photography with guest contributions is set to gain momentum. Couples can encourage their guests to take photos throughout the day using mobile apps or social media platforms, creating a shared album that captures both the professional and candid moments. For example, apps like WedPics allow guests to upload their images, which can be curated into a final wedding album alongside the photographer's work. This not only enriches the narrative of the wedding day but also allows couples to see different perspectives through the eyes of their friends and family. By blending these two styles, couples can create a more authentic and diverse representation of their celebration, making their wedding album a true reflection of the joy felt by everyone present.
